Modesto, USA – A Classic All-American City
Something amazing happened on March 1, 2011. The Modesto City Council approved the special designation of 10th and 11th Streets as the Historic Graffiti Cruise Route. This is such a huge milestone in the history of Modesto and for the future of our city. Modesto has a very special brand, one that is all about […]
